A Brief Overview of Princess Charlene
Charlene Wittstock, originally from South Africa, became the Princess of Monaco upon marrying Prince Albert II in July 2011. Since then, she has dedicated herself to various charitable causes, including initiatives focused on children’s health, the environment, and sports. Her background as an Olympic swimmer has also given her a unique perspective on physical wellness and fitness advocacy.

Philanthropy and Impact
The Princess has played an instrumental role in transforming the charitable landscape of Monaco. Since the establishment of the Princess Charlene of Monaco Foundation in 2012, she has focused on projects that promote educational opportunities for children worldwide. The foundation has successfully launched swimming programs in underprivileged areas, encouraging water safety and fitness among young people.
Challenges and Resilience
Despite her success, Princess Charlene’s journey has not been without trials. In late 2021, she faced a health scare that kept her away from Monaco for several months. Her absence raised concerns among the public about her wellbeing and the future of the Monégasque royal family. However, upon her return, she has been received warmly, showing that her resilience has only deepened her connection with the people.
